What is Chardham Yatra & Why Registration Online?

Many travellers undertake a divine yatra to Chardham in the state of Uttarakhand—four divine houses: Yamunotri, Gangotri, Kedarnath, and Badrinath. The holy yatra is called the Chardham Yatra. To deal with the massive number of pilgrims, and in the interests of safety, the Uttarakhand government requires chardham registration online (and offline) prior to beginning the Chardham yatra.

What Does “Chardham Registration Online” Mean?

When you hear chardham registration online, it means using a web portal or mobile app to give your details (name, ID, contact, dates) and get a registration slip or e-pass that shows you are officially registered to visit the four Dhams.

This registration helps the authorities:

  1. Keep track of how many pilgrims are traveling
  2. Help in rescue or help in emergencies
  3. Organize services (road, medical, lodging)
  4. Control crowd and avoid chaos

Hence chardham registration online is not just formal; it is a safety and planning measure.

Also, the registration is free — no charge for pilgrims to register.

Official Portal & App for Chardham Registration Online

Official Website

The official portal for chardham registration online is:

registrationandtouristcare.uk.gov.in 

This is the Uttarakhand government’s “Tourist Care / Tourist Registration” portal. You go there, sign up or log in, and then register your tour and pilgrims. 

Mobile App

There is also an official mobile app: Tourist Care Uttarakhand, which works on Android and iOS. Through this app you can do chardham registration online from your phone.

The app is helpful because you can access the registration, check the status, and even download the registration letter (with QR code) from mobile.

Other Digital Modes

Apart from the portal and app, there are a couple more digital ways:

  • WhatsApp mode: If you send “Yatra” to +91 8394833833, you can register via chat.
  • Toll free / helpline: There is a number 0135-1364 (or 1364) to call for help or registration.
  • Offline / physical counters: In case you miss doing chardham registration online, there are counters at Haridwar, Rishikesh, Barkot, Hina, Sonprayag, Pandukeshwar etc.

So, chardham registration online is the easiest, but you have other fallbacks.

Step-by-Step: How to Do Chardham Registration Online

Here is a step-by-step guide to complete your chardham registration online in a simple way. Use it like a checklist.

  1. Open portal/app.
    Go to the portal registrationandtouristcare.uk.gov.in, or open “Tourist Care Uttarakhand.” app.
  2. Sign Up / Register
    If you are a new user, click on “Register / Sign Up.” Enter name, mobile number, choose type (Individual, Family, or Tour Operator), and set a password.
  3. Login
    Use your mobile number, password, and captcha/OTP to login into your account.
  4. Create / Manage Tour
    After login, there is a dashboard. Click on “Create / Manage Tour.” Then choose “Add New Tour.”
  5. Enter Tour Details
    Fill start date, end date, number of pilgrims, the order of Dhams you will go to, what mode of travel (by road, by foot, etc.).
  6. Add Pilgrims’ Details
    For each pilgrim (you and others if going together), enter name, age, gender, address, contact, medical condition if any, emergency contact, etc.
  7. Upload ID Proof / Photo
    Scan and upload a valid photo identity (Aadhaar, Voter ID, Passport, Driving License) and a passport photograph in digital format.
  8. Verify Aadhaar / OTP
    The portal may ask you to verify your Aadhaar or send OTP to mobile to confirm your identity.
  9. Submit / Save
    After filling all, check everything, agree to any declaration, and submit. Then the portal generates a registration letter / e-pass with QR code.
  10. Download Registration Letter / Yatra Card
    From the dashboard or “Manage Tour,” download the registration letter as PDF or e-pass. Carry it with you (either printed or on phone).

This completes the chardham registration online process.

After registration, you might also get a darshan slot token in some Dhams, so that darshan is done in an orderly way.

Documents & Information You Must Keep Ready

To make chardham registration online smooth, keep these ready in advance:

  • Valid photo identification: Aadhaar card, voter ID, passport or driving license.
  • Recent passport size photo (digital)
  • Mobile number & email
  • Address proof (if needed)
  • Emergency contact person’s name and phone
  • Medical info (if any condition)
  • Travel plan: dates, number of days, order of Dhams
  • Vehicle details (if travelling by private car / taxi)

Having these in hand makes chardham registration online fast.

When To Do Registration & Temple Opening Dates

  • The Chardham Yatra usually opens in April or May and closes in October/November which is subject to weather conditions.
  • For example, in 2025 the temples open:
     • Yamunotri: 30 April 2025
     • Gangotri: 30 April 2025
     • Kedarnath: early May 2025 (not confirmed)
     • Badrinath: 4 May 2025

You should try to do the chardham registration online well in advance—before you begin the travel—so that your slot and documentation are ready. Don’t wait till the last minute.

Also note: If you start late, some Dhams may have heavy rush or limited slots.

Checkpoints & Verification During Yatra

Even after you do chardham registration online, you will be checked at various registration checkpoints en route. Authorities verify your registration letter or QR code at these points.

Typical checkpoints are:

  • Barkot (for Yamunotri)
  • Hina (for Gangotri)
  • Sonprayag (for Kedarnath)
  • Pandukeshwar (for Badrinath)
  • Govind Ghat / Pulna for Hemkund Sahib (if included)

You may also need to show your registration letter / QR at the temple gates or darshan counters. So always carry the digital or print copy.

If authorities find you unregistered, you may be denied darshan or entry. That is why chardham registration online is not optional.

Common Questions & Tips for Chardham Yatra (FAQ)

Q. Is registration mandatory?
Yes, if anyone wants to visit the four Dhams, doing chardham registration online (or offline) is required.

Q. Is there a fee for registration?
No. The registration is free of cost.

Q. Can I edit my registration after submitting?
Some details can’t be changed after submission. So check carefully before you submit your chardham registration online form.

Q. What if I forget to register online?
You can still register at physical registration counters (Haridwar, Rishikesh, etc.). But this is riskier and might cause delays.

Q. What happens if there is bad weather or a flood?
Because authorities know the list of registered pilgrims, they can communicate or rescue more effectively. That is one of the reasons chardham registration online was introduced.

Q. Can foreigners register via chardham registration online?
Yes, the portal accepts foreigners too. You would need to show your passport or valid ID.

Q. Is there biometric scanning?
Yes, the registration process is biometric / photometric to ensure authenticity.

Q. How long is the registration valid?
It is valid for that particular Yatra season, for the dates you select.

Q. Should I carry a printout or phone copy?
Carry both — printed copy and the digital copy (on phone) of your chardham registration online letter.

Possible Challenges & What to Watch Out For

  • Sometimes, the portal may face load or maintenance—so registration may be slow
  • If your photo or ID is not clear, it might get rejected
  • If you change your plan (dates or Dhams) mid-way, you may face trouble
  • In remote areas, network might be poor
  • In case of natural disasters or weather issues, the yatra might be paused
  • Do not trust fake websites for chardham registration online—always use the official portal
  • Be aware of fraudulent helicopter bookings or false websites—the Uttarakhand government has warned about fake sites.
